BCLCs Disaster Forum:
Lessons Learned About Long-Term Recovery
March 15, 2007
8:30 a.m. to 2:00 p.m.
U.S. Chamber of Commerce
Washington, D.C.
BCLCs Business Disaster Assistance and Recovery Program continues in 2007 with this forum, Lessons Learned about Long-Term Recovery which will capture experiences from the Gulf Coast recovery and other experiences and insights regarding the role of business in long-term recovery and community resilience. Our panel of experts will explore:
-Public Policy, Business and Community Recovery
-Local Lessons Learned About Community Recovery
-Lessons Learned from Industry and from the States
Donald E. Powell, Federal Coordinator of Gulf Coast Rebuilding, U.S. Department of Homeland Security to Serve as Keynote Speaker
In addition, we will have an Open Mic working lunch in which we invite YOU to share your thoughts on long-term recovery issues.
